The Safdie Brothers and Adam Sandler were, incredibly, totally ignored by the Oscars for their basketball-and-bum-tattoos thriller Uncut Gems, but they've not let that get them down. In fact, they've just knocked out another five-minute short together.

In Goldman V Silverman – they're still obsessed with high value minerals, clearly – Sandler is a cantankerous and quite rubbish street performer, 'Goldman'. He's painted gold, obviously, and pretends to be a robot. But that also happens to be the act of 'Silverman', played by Benny Safdie, who turns up and starts taking the piss out of him. As you can imagine, Goldman doesn't like that at all.

Photo credit: Safdie Brothers/Elara
Photo credit: Safdie Brothers/Elara

Is it a high-octane thrill ride which ratchets up the tension at every available opportunity while also making you consider the vast and unknowable power of the cosmos? No. But it is quite funny and quite sad, and is comfortably Sandler's second best performance since Punch Drunk Love.
